Share of cumulative CO2 emissions in the Democratic Republic of the Congo in 2024 — 0.013%. Ranked 89 in the world out of 214. Since 1920, the indicator has risen by 0.013 pp.

About the indicator

A country's share of total global carbon dioxide emissions since 1750. It is cumulative emissions rather than annual ones that determine the concentration of CO2 reached in the atmosphere, because carbon dioxide remains there for centuries. This measure, not the current share, is what stands behind the notion of historical responsibility: a few countries that began burning coal in the 19th century have built up a contribution out of all proportion to their present weight in emissions.

Important: Borders have shifted over 250 years, and emissions are assigned to the present-day borders of the territory where they occurred — comparisons with colonial empires on this measure are therefore not entirely sound.
